Problema con ActionMailer

Ciao a tutti,
premesso che uso Linux e Postfix come MTA ho il seguente problema.
Se in development.rb inserisco

ActionMailer::Base.server_settings = {
:address => “out.alice.it”,
:port => 25,
:domain => “alice.it”,
:authentication => :login
}

ho un errore di tipo connection reset by peer

se invece in development.rb inserisco solamente la riga

ActionMailer::Base.delivery_method :sendmail

l’invio della mail avviene correttamente.
Dove sbaglio ad impostare i parametri per Alice nel primo caso?
Grazie mille.

Osvaldo F. ha scritto:

A occhio e croce non vedo username e password per il login :slight_smile:
E cmq se sendmail va bene perché vuoi usare alice? :smiley:

Grazie mille per le risposte.
In effetti mi e’ bastato tolgiere :authentication => :login
per risolvere il problema.
Ad ogni modo seguiro’ il vostro consiglio.
Grazie ancora. Ciao.

  • Saturday 11 November 2006, alle 13:10, david scrive:

Solitamente non hai bisogno di autenticarti per SPEDIRE (smtp), solo
per ricevere. Per questo motivo la maggior parte dei provider non
permette la spedizione di mail se la richiesta del client non
proviene
da reti “conosciute”, tipo alice stessa… Fastweb fa così e libero
pure. Anche noi alla rete civica facciamo così.
Quindi, se sei conesso ad alice quando esegui questo codice - e se
togli :authentication - dovrebbe andare; se vuoi che il codice giri
dapertutto fai meglio a usare un smtp locale, come sendmail o
postfix.
Usando un portatile e cambiando spesso rete mi sono stufato di questi
problemi e spedisco tutte le mail con un smtp server locale, così va
(quasi) sempre e da qualsiasi rete!
:slight_smile:
Giovanni I. wrote:

 Osvaldo F. ha scritto:
 A occhio e croce non vedo username e password per il login :)
 E cmq se sendmail va bene perché vuoi usare alice? :D

 Ciao a tutti,
 premesso che uso Linux e Postfix come MTA ho il seguente problema.
 Se in development.rb inserisco
 ActionMailer::Base.server_settings = {
   :address => "out.alice.it",
   :port => 25,
   :domain => "alice.it",
   :authentication => :login
 }

_______________________________________________________________________

Ml mailing list
[1][email protected]
[2]http://lists.ruby-it.org/mailman/listinfo/ml


“Remember, always be yourself. Unless you suck.” - Joss Whedon

References

  1. mailto:[email protected]
  2. http://lists.ruby-it.org/mailman/listinfo/ml

Di niente!
:slight_smile:
Osvaldo F. wrote:

Grazie mille per le risposte.
In effetti mi e’ bastato tolgiere :authentication => :login
per risolvere il problema.
Ad ogni modo seguiro’ il vostro consiglio.
Grazie ancora. Ciao.

  • Saturday 11 November 2006, alle 13:10, david scrive:

    Solitamente non hai bisogno di autenticarti per SPEDIRE (smtp), solo
    per ricevere. Per questo motivo la maggior parte dei provider non
    permette la spedizione di mail se la richiesta del client non
    proviene
    da reti “conosciute”, tipo alice stessa… Fastweb fa così e libero
    pure. Anche noi alla rete civica facciamo
    così. Quindi, se sei conesso ad alice quando esegui questo codice - e se
    togli :authentication - dovrebbe andare; se vuoi che il codice giri
    dapertutto fai meglio a usare un smtp locale, come sendmail o
    postfix.
    Usando un portatile e cambiando spesso rete mi sono stufato di questi
    problemi e spedisco tutte le mail con un smtp server locale, così va
    (quasi) sempre e da qualsiasi rete!
    :slight_smile:
    Giovanni I. wrote:

    Osvaldo F. ha scritto:
    A occhio e croce non vedo username e password per il login :slight_smile:
    E cmq se sendmail va bene perché vuoi usare alice? :smiley:

    Ciao a tutti,
    premesso che uso Linux e Postfix come MTA ho il seguente problema.
    Se in development.rb inserisco
    ActionMailer::Base.server_settings = {
    :address => “out.alice.it”,
    :port => 25,
    :domain => “alice.it”,
    :authentication => :login
    }